Once in the past I had an app default the tnsnames.ora to
$TNS_ADMIN/sample/tnsnames.ora instead of $TNS_ADMIN/tnsnames.ora.

 

You might check and make sure its not trying to go to the sample
tnsnames, perhaps by moving, renaming, or deleting it.

I had a weird situation where I had 3 PC and Oracle 10g Client is
installed on them. I had installed one of the VB application on all
three connecting to Oracle 10g DB.

 

One PC is able to read the Service correctly and connect to the database
while others are not

 

THere is only One Oracle Home on them

 

Sqlplus work fine in connecting to the Database and So TNS Service or
alias are correct

 

I tried to trace parameter in sqlnet.ora but found that only Sqlplus
connection is only creating Trace file while there is no trace file
created with VB Access which look like that it is not reading the
Tnsnames.

 

No Oracle errors except database does not exist

 

I had also added TNS_ADMIN in environment pointing to OH/network/admin

 

Any other suggestion
